Making Meaning in Popular Romance Fiction: An Epistemology
Jayashree Kamble
Despite pioneering studies, the term 'romance novel' itself has not been subjected to scrutiny. This book examines mass-market romance fiction in the U. K., Canada, and the U. S. through four categories: capitalism, war, heterosexuality, and white Protestantism and casts a fresh light on the genre.
